A.  Speed - how much distance an object covers per unit time

 

1. Speed = distance / time

a) Units - m/s, km/hour, miles/hour

 

 

Ex 1) An object travels 5 meters in 2 seconds. Find its speed.

 

 

 

 

 

 

Answer: Speed = d/t

 

= 5m/2 sec = 2.5 m/s

 

 

Ex 2) An object moves at a rate of 3 m/s for 1.5 seconds. How far did the object move?

 

 

 

 

Answer: Speed = d/t

 

3 m/s = d/1.5 sec  

 

d = 4.5 m 

 

Ex 3) An object moves at rate of 4 m/s over a distance of 10 meters. How long did it travel.

 

 

 

Answer: Speed = d/t

 

4 m/s = 10 m/t

 

(4 m/s)t = 10 m

 

t = 2.5 seconds
